Trio Recalled by AHL's Stars

November 10, 2014 - ECHL (ECHL)
Idaho Steelheads News Release


Boise, ID (11/10/14) - Head Coach and Director of Hockey Operations Brad Ralph announced Monday morning that three players have been recalled from the ECHL's Idaho Steelheads by Texas of the American Hockey League.

Defenseman Mike Dalhuisen and forwards Jesse Root and Branden Troock have all re-joined Texas on the road in Charlotte.

Root is tied for eighth among ECHL rookies in scoring with ten points (four goals, six assists), registering at least one point in six of the eight games he has played with Idaho. Troock appeared in five games with Idaho, scoring his first professional goal and adding one assist as well. Dalhuisen appeared in two games last week against Colorado, picking up one five-minute fighting major.

Idaho and Texas are the primary development affiliates of the NHL's Dallas Stars.

Idaho (7-2-1) returns home Tuesday night to host the Alaska Aces. Game time is 7:10 PM. The same two teams will play Wednesday night as well.
